The phrase "I don't care" is introduced in this chapter as more of a reflecting point.  Through the point of exhaustion in a relationship where the main character felt a spike in craving adventure yet stagnant in pain from being overloaded with information and feelings of being suspended in the air and not chosen in love.  A verbal "I don't care" in combination with the feelings and emotions of apathy and numbness gives weight to truth.  Allowing all of your senses to be numbed, your feelings unheard, hearing to deaf, appetite incomplete, your voice of the silenced, and your sight from coloured to grey.  Now where is the joy and happiness?  Now where are you?    Lead yourself to where you do care and it will align you to attracting those items, people, or attributes.  A few more existential questions to add to your list of written prompts and the easier it is to become the answers that you seek.  Your vision is brought to reality.
